Lee Dong Wook Wears Traditional Robes For Upcoming Episode Of tvN’s “Goblin"

C1Y6ZmhUsAAaKVd.jpg

The latest stills for tvN’s “Goblin” show Lee Dong Wook dressed in traditional Goryeo robes. Continue reading to find out what’s in store for the upcoming episode!

At the end of episode 10, it is revealed that Sunny (played by Yoo In Na) is the reincarnation of Kim Shin’s younger sister Kim Sun. At the same time, the episode ends with a scene showing the grim reaper dressed in a traditional robe, revealing that the grim reaper was the king in his past life.

The latest stills provide another glimpse of the king, who is seen with an expression of profound sadness on his face. Many are curious to see how Lee Dong Wook will portray the king as his backstory unfolds.

The production team also revealed, “With Lee Dong Wook playing both the king and the grim reaper, he is continuously working hard and is doing an in-depth study on how to play two characters with different emotions. The upcoming episode will actively be showing the Goryeo king’s past story.”

“Goblin” airs every Friday and Saturday.

Sam Kim Talks About His Experience In Singing “Who Are You” OST For tvN’s “Goblin”

C1ZPCBUUUAEAPTd.jpg

Artist Sam Kim recently talked about his experience in singing the OST for tvN’s “Goblin.”

On January 5, Sam Kim was a guest on SBS Power FM’s “2 O’Clock Escape Cultwo Show,” where a few of the members from APRIL were present as well.

During the broadcast, Sam Kim expressed his feelings in getting first place on major music charts with “Who Are You,” saying, “Thank you so much.”

When the DJs asked him, “Why are you not singing this song for us today?” Sam Kim replied, “The song is so hard [to sing] that I’m still practicing it,” causing everyone to break out in laughter.

Meanwhile, Sam Kim’s OST for “Goblin” is the theme song for the drama’s main character Kim Shin, and contains lyrics that describe one man’s eager heart as he stands in front of a fateful love.
